Transaction 658f573be2335f1f0ed5649114addb5af69fa143bb0e83b1019afaaf18804404
1 Input
1 Output
-
658f573be2335f1f0ed5649114addb5af69fa143bb0e83b1019afaaf18804404:0
- value
- 107493
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c275105940db5a026900570e8ec51b5665f429b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1J9s8pfdvByyoaS4R6Xaq68ptFp8tk9FTm